Ignoring Blank Pages

The printer detects the printing data from computer whether a page is empty or includes any data. To skip
the blank pages at printing document, follow these steps:

Press Scroll ( or ) to highlight Setup and then press Select (

).

1.

Press Scroll (

or

) to highlight Machine Setup and then press Select (

).

2.

Press Scroll (

or

) to highlight Print Blank Pages and then press Select (

).

3.

Press Scroll (

or

) to change the setting to Do Not Print .

4.

Press Select (

) to save the selection.

5.

Press Cancel (

) to return to the Standby mode.

Setting the Job Management

Press Scroll ( or ) to highlight Setup and then press Select (

).

1.

Press Scroll (

or

) to highlight Job Management and then press Select (

).

2.

Press Scroll (

or

) to display the option and then press Select (

).

Stored Jobs : Print jobs currently stored in the hard disk. When a user sends a confidential job
from PC to the device, it will hold the job until you release it with your password.

Job Expiration : Limits the amount of time a confidential job stays in the printer before it is
deleted.

Clear Stored Job : You can delete jobs currently stored in the hard disk and RAM disk. If you
select the ALL , all Secure Jobs and Stored Prints are deleted.

3.

Set each option as you want and then press Select (

).

4.

Press Cancel (

) to return to the Standby mode.
